We all know that San Francisco is an expensive city in which to live. According to the website expatistan.com, a random sample of figures at June 11th 2018 show the rent for a 900 sq ft furnished apartment in a standard area was $3,500 a month, while in an expensive area it was over $4,100. 1lb of boneless chicken breast was $7, while lunch in the Financial District was $16.

A cleaner was $32 an hour, and 12oz of hair shampoo was $8. A 500ml beer in a local pub was $7, while dinner for two at an Italian restaurant was $114, and gym membership was $99 a month.

The Majority Of Patients Are Suitable for Dental Implants

Not all patients are suitable for dental implants, but the good news once again is that the vast majority of people are. The way they work is actually fairly simple to explain. A small titanium screw (the same metal used for aircraft) is inserted into the jawbone, and over a period of several weeks the jawbone and the implant fuse together in a process known as osseointegration. Once this process is complete, an artificial tooth is fitted to the implant and – hey presto! – you have a tooth that is as good as the original.

Dental implants are great because they don’t cause any damage to the surrounding teeth as a bridge would, and they are about as permanent as you can get. In fact, they may very often “live” as long as you do.
